For those who have not spent time on the tarmac... as part of the noise level requirement changes back in the mid-late 90s, most jets were retrofitted with silencers or new engines.
Now, what does this mean in a practical sense? I've been on the tarmac as a 757 was taxiing away towards the runway. When the engine is pointed directly at you, very little noise, but as you got 10-20 degrees off-axis, there was a clearly audible jet engine sound which then faded away as the jet pivoted to turn around. It was not what I expected, acoustic-wise from a jet engine.
